]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- drivers/scsi/libsas/sas_expander.c
[SCSI] libsas: don't use made up error codes
[karo-tx-linux.git] / drivers / scsi / libsas / sas_expander.c
index 8aeaad95242c9bf1efa4d9a6cdb36f22684bad4d..aefd865a578862e3bf17b4a8d6a7f8a4a8aaffef 100644 (file)
@@ -96,7 +96,7 @@ static int smp_execute_task(struct domain_device *dev, void *req, int req_size,
                }
 
                wait_for_completion(&task->completion);
-               res = -ETASK;
+               res = -ECOMM;
                if ((task->task_state_flags & SAS_TASK_STATE_ABORTED)) {
                        SAS_DPRINTK("smp task timed out or aborted\n");
                        i->dft->lldd_abort_task(task);